Cumberland County Pools:

FCPR pools opened for the swim season on Memorial Day, Mon. May 25.

Hours of Operation: *Please verify info as it can change from time to time*
Tuesday-Saturday: 10 am-6 pm
Sunday: 1-6 pm
(Keith A. Bates, Sr. Pool public swim hours are 3-6 pm when school is in session)

Cost:
Resident: $3 for ages 12 and under; $4 for ages 13+
Non-resident: $6 for ages 12 and under; $8 for ages 13+

Please keep in mind that all flotation devices must be “Coast Guard Approved”. Prohibited items include, but are not limited to: water wings, inner tubes, rafts, noodles, flotation suits or other non-coast guard approved devices. 


Keith A. Bates, Sr. Pool

4945 Rosehill Road Fayetteville 28311

features a kiddie pool, lap pool with six lanes and a 24-foot enclosed water slide.


Ronnie "Chase" Chalmers Pool

1520 Slater Avenue Fayetteville 28301

features a 6-lane lap pool and a wading pool with a zero entry and a water playground area.


Lake Rim Aquatic Center

2265 Tar Kiln Drive Fayetteville 28304

features a wading pool complete with an in-water playground, competitive pool with six lanes and an 18-foot-high water slide


Westover Aquatic Center

266 Bonanza Drive Fayetteville 28303

features an 8-lane competition pool and a wading pool with a zero entry and a 12-foot-high water slide.
